Syng aims to change home audio with the Cell Alpha smart speaker
The designers behind the HomePod have been quietly working on a new speaker that uses spatial audio technology to fill your home with an immersive listening experience. The company's first product is a speaker called Cell Alpha, an orb-like design that packs two woofers, three pairs of tweeters and mid-frequency drivers, and three microphones that can tune the speaker based on the acoustics of the room. Cell Alpha can be linked with additional speakers and connecting three of them is said to be able to mimic a 7.1 channel system.
Available Spring 2021.
